About This Episode
In this episode of the Mommy Actor Podcast, I sit down with actress, writer, producer, and comedian Lyric Lewis—best known for playing the sharp and hilarious history teacher Stef Duncan on the NBC comedy A.P. Bio.
Lyric opens up about a moment many working actors quietly worry about: finding out you're pregnant while starring on a television show. After wrapping the second season of A.P. Bio, Lyric discovered she was expecting—just as the show was renewed.
Instead of fear or uncertainty, what she experienced surprised her. From the writers’ room to the set, the team rallied around her, creating an environment where she could continue doing what she loved while stepping into motherhood.
This episode is a candid conversation about navigating pregnancy while working in Hollywood, the reality of being a series regular, and why supportive workplaces make all the difference.

About Lyric Lewis
Lyric Lewis is an actress, writer, and comedian known for her breakout role as Stef Duncan on A.P. Bio, the NBC comedy that later continued streaming on Peacock for a total of four seasons.
Originally from New Orleans and raised partly in Minnesota, Lyric developed a love of performing early on and later earned a BFA in Theater from Syracuse University.
She went on to train and perform with the legendary Los Angeles improv and sketch comedy theater The Groundlings, eventually becoming a Main Company member—an honor achieved by only a small group of performers after years of training and performing.
In addition to A.P. Bio, Lyric has appeared on shows including Brooklyn Nine-Nine, Baskets, and MADtv, building a career that blends improv, sketch comedy, and television acting.
